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[EVENT] OceanHackWeek August 26-30 #4469

Closed
3 of 11 tasks
abkfenris opened this issue Jul 22, 2024 · 5 comments
Closed
3 of 11 tasks

[EVENT] OceanHackWeek August 26-30 #4469

abkfenris opened this issue Jul 22, 2024 · 5 comments
Assignees

Comments

@abkfenris
Copy link
Contributor

abkfenris commented Jul 22, 2024

The link towards the Freshdesk ticket this event was reported

Discussed via email

The GitHub handle or name of the community representative

@abkfenris, @cpsarason

The date when the event will start

August 24th, 5 AM Eastern

The date when the event will end

August 30th 5 PM Eastern

What hours of the day will participants be active? (e.g., 5am - 5pm US/Pacific)

8-5, but hacking will likely continue for all hours

Are we three weeks before the start date of the event?

  • Yes
  • No

Number of attendees

35

Make sure to add the event into the calendar

  • Done

Does the hub already exist?

  • Yes
  • No

The URL of the hub that will be used for the event

https://oceanhackweek.2i2c.cloud/hub/login?next=%2Fhub%2F

Will this hub be decommissioned after the event is over?

  • Yes
  • No

Was all the info filled in above?

  • Yes
  • No

Quotas from the cloud provider are high-enough to handle expected usage?

  • Yes
  • No
@abkfenris
Copy link
Contributor Author

Could we get access to upload data to GCS via Google Groups auth for our tutorials? https://infrastructure.2i2c.org/howto/features/buckets/#allowing-authenticated-access-to-buckets-from-outside-the-jupyterhub

@yuvipanda yuvipanda self-assigned this Aug 6, 2024
abkfenris added a commit to abkfenris/infrastructure-1 that referenced this issue Aug 13, 2024
First update to OceanHackWeek's Python image for 2024 (we're trying pixi!). Additionally updating our user groups and adding Christian as an admin.

xref 2i2c-org#4469
abkfenris added a commit to abkfenris/infrastructure-1 that referenced this issue Aug 13, 2024
The pixi environment management experiment continues. 

I missed testing if pixi-kernel could find the base environment after changing the install directory, but JupyterLab worked and installing a new environment in a subdirectory worked as well.

oceanhackweek/jupyter-image#79

xref 2i2c-org#4469
abkfenris added a commit to abkfenris/infrastructure-1 that referenced this issue Aug 19, 2024
A few more OceanHackWeekn tutorial presenters provided their dependencies, so I've updated the image so they can test their tutorials.

xref 2i2c-org#4469
@yuvipanda yuvipanda assigned jmunroe and unassigned yuvipanda Aug 21, 2024
@jmunroe
Copy link
Contributor

jmunroe commented Aug 21, 2024

Hi @abkfenris! I just noticed your question here:

Could we get access to upload data to GCS via Google Groups auth for our tutorials? https://infrastructure.2i2c.org/howto/features/buckets/#allowing-authenticated-access-to-buckets-from-outside-the-jupyterhub

In future, could you please send requests like this through support@2i2c.org so it gets picked up by our regular support process? (I'll create a ticket on your behalf to capture this)

Is this still issue something you need assistance with?

@abkfenris
Copy link
Contributor Author

Sorry, I don't have a good handle of which requests go where now. I got back to you via email.

abkfenris added a commit to abkfenris/infrastructure-1 that referenced this issue Aug 23, 2024
A few more dependencies for our tutorials.

xref 2i2c-org#4469
@abkfenris
Copy link
Contributor Author

#4687 updates our images for a cert change that is preventing login to Github.

@abkfenris
Copy link
Contributor Author

Random thought/feedback as we go:

We've had some hiccups using gh-scoped-creds this week. Tokens seemed to expire very quickly, or not be acquired at all with unclear errors. Most of the participants have switched to persistent auth with gh auth login.

Image loading wasn't too bad in most cases, but I had the thought, are you using ECR to cache images? I've set it up for one of my k8s clusters and it has massively speed up launching.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

4 participants